How to open a step file....

This is robably a really primitive question. We're trying to put the AndyMark 2 Speed Gearboxes into inventor, but don't know how to open the step file so that we can see the dimensions that we need. Can somebody help?

Re: How to open a step file....

if you want step by step instructions here they are:

1) open file menu
2) click on "open"
3) go to "types of file", and open the list, and scroll down to step file, it should have (*.stp, *.ste*,.step) next to it, and select it
4) browse for your file like you would any
5) click open
